Top Story: Databricks Acquires MosaicML
Databricks announced today that it has acquired AI infrastructure startup MosaicML for $1.3 billion in a cash and stock transaction. This deal marks Databricks’ largest acquisition to date and strengthens its position in the rapidly growing enterprise AI infrastructure market.
The acquisition provides Databricks with immediate access to MosaicML’s specialized hardware optimizations and training platform. This technology enables companies to build and deploy custom large language models more efficiently and can reduce training costs by up to 70% compared to standard industry solutions.
Ali Ghodsi, CEO of Databricks, stated that this acquisition accelerates Databricks’ vision to democratize AI for enterprises of all sizes. Ghodsi highlighted that MosaicML’s technology would enable customers to develop proprietary AI models without the high computational expenses typically associated with large language model development.

Also Today: AI Hardware Evolution
NVIDIA’s Hopper H200 GPU Now Shipping
NVIDIA has begun shipping its new Hopper H200 GPU accelerators to cloud providers and enterprise customers. The H200 delivers 1.9 times faster performance on large language model inference compared to the previous H100 model.
Initial benchmarks indicate that the H200 can process complex AI workloads with significantly reduced latency. This makes it particularly valuable for real-time applications in sectors such as financial services and healthcare. The new GPU features 141GB of HBM3e memory, a 43% increase over the previous generation.
Major cloud providers including AWS, Google Cloud, and Microsoft Azure have announced immediate availability of H200 instances for their customers. Pricing reflects a 15 to 20 percent premium over equivalent H100 deployments.
Intel’s Gaudi 3 AI Accelerator Gains Traction
Intel reported that adoption of its Gaudi 3 AI accelerators is surpassing internal projections, with shipments doubling quarter over quarter. The company attributes this growth to competitive pricing and improved power efficiency, expanding Gaudi 3’s market share in the data center segment.
Several major enterprises, including Walmart and Morgan Stanley, have recently deployed Gaudi 3 clusters to support their internal AI initiatives. Intel’s accelerator has shown particular strength in computer vision applications and natural language processing for document analysis.
Pat Gelsinger, CEO of Intel, stated that the physical infrastructure of AI is evolving beyond the chips themselves. Gelsinger emphasized the importance of integrated cooling, power delivery, and interconnect technologies for customers facing real-world deployment challenges.
Samsung Announces 3nm Process Improvements
Samsung Electronics has reported significant yield improvements in its 3-nanometer chip manufacturing process, achieving what it describes as “production-ready status” for AI-focused designs. This development could position Samsung as a stronger competitor to TSMC in the high-performance computing segment.
The improved process enables 30% better power efficiency and 15% performance gains over the previous generation. Samsung stated it has secured five new customers for its 3nm process, though specific companies were not disclosed.
Industry analysts note that this advancement may help diversify the supply chain for advanced AI chips, an area currently constrained by limited manufacturing capacity. The first commercial products based on Samsung’s improved process are expected to reach the market in the second quarter of 2026.
